    When considering the optimal age for undergoing Ultrasonic Cavitation in Austin, it's important to understand that this procedure is designed to target localized fat deposits and cellulite, which can be a concern at various stages of life. Generally, individuals in their mid-20s to early 40s often seek this treatment as they may be more focused on maintaining or achieving a toned physique. However, the best age can vary based on individual body composition, lifestyle, and personal goals.

    For younger individuals, such as those in their early 20s, Ultrasonic Cavitation might be considered if they have specific areas of stubborn fat that are resistant to diet and exercise. This age group typically has higher collagen levels and better skin elasticity, which can enhance the results of the treatment.

    For those in their 30s, Ultrasonic Cavitation can be an effective way to address changes in body composition that may occur due to factors like stress, hormonal shifts, or lifestyle changes. This age group might also be more proactive about maintaining their physical appearance, making them ideal candidates for the procedure.

    In the 40s and beyond, individuals may experience more significant changes in body fat distribution and skin elasticity. Ultrasonic Cavitation can help in reducing these effects, but it's crucial to have realistic expectations and to combine the treatment with a healthy lifestyle for the best results.

    Ultimately, the best age for Ultrasonic Cavitation in Austin is when an individual feels ready to address their specific concerns about body fat and cellulite. Consulting with a qualified medical professional can provide personalized advice and ensure that the procedure is performed safely and effectively.

    Understanding the Ideal Age for Ultrasonic Cavitation in Austin

    Ultrasonic Cavitation, a non-invasive body contouring treatment, has gained popularity for its ability to reduce fat and tighten skin. However, determining the best age for this procedure requires a nuanced understanding of individual health, lifestyle, and aesthetic goals.

    Age Range and Suitability

    Generally, individuals in their mid-20s to early 40s often find Ultrasonic Cavitation most beneficial. This age group typically has good skin elasticity and a higher metabolism, which can enhance the treatment's effectiveness. However, it's important to note that age is just one factor; personal circumstances and health conditions play a significant role in determining suitability.

    Health Considerations

    Before undergoing Ultrasonic Cavitation, it's crucial to assess overall health. Conditions such as diabetes, cardiovascular diseases, and certain skin disorders may contraindicate the procedure. Consulting with a healthcare professional can help ensure that the treatment is safe and appropriate for your specific health profile.

    Lifestyle and Aesthetic Goals

    Lifestyle factors, including diet, exercise, and stress levels, can influence the outcome of Ultrasonic Cavitation. Those who maintain a healthy lifestyle may experience better results and faster recovery. Additionally, understanding your aesthetic goals is essential. Whether you aim to reduce localized fat deposits or tighten loose skin, setting realistic expectations can guide your decision-making process.

    Professional Consultation

    Ultimately, the best age for Ultrasonic Cavitation in Austin is highly individualized. A thorough consultation with a qualified medical professional can provide personalized insights and recommendations. During this consultation, your medical history, current health status, and aesthetic objectives will be discussed to determine if Ultrasonic Cavitation is the right choice for you.

    In conclusion, while the mid-20s to early 40s age range is often considered optimal, the decision to undergo Ultrasonic Cavitation should be based on a comprehensive evaluation of health, lifestyle, and aesthetic goals. Consulting with a healthcare professional ensures that you make an informed decision tailored to your unique circumstances.
